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is a powerful tool in the digital marketing arsenal, but it can also act as a revealing light that highlights inconsistencies within a brand’s content strategy. This article explores how SEO can expose these discrepancies and the impact they have on brand perception and performance.

As businesses strive to enhance their online presence, the role of SEO becomes increasingly critical. Not only does SEO help in improving visibility, but it also provides insights into the coherence of the brand’s messaging across various platforms. When there is a misalignment between what a brand claims to represent and the content it produces, SEO can inadvertently highlight these inconsistencies, potentially affecting customer trust and business growth.

Understanding SEO and Brand Consistency

SEO involves optimizing web content to rank higher in search engine results. Brand consistency, on the other hand, refers to the uniformity in the presentation of the brand’s identity across all marketing channels, reinforcing the brand’s message and values. When these two areas are not aligned, it can lead to mixed signals that confuse the audience and dilute the brand’s message.

Signals of Misalignment in SEO

Several indicators can signal misalignment between SEO practices and brand messaging:

  • Varying tone and style in content across different platforms
  • Inconsistent keyword usage that does not reflect the brand’s core values
  • Conflicting information or promises that lead to customer distrust
  • SEO strategies that prioritize rankings over quality content that resonates with the brand’s identity

Case Studies

Examining real-life scenarios helps in understanding the impact of SEO misalignment:

Case Study 1: The Fashion Retailer

A leading fashion brand noticed a drop in user engagement despite aggressive SEO tactics. Upon analysis, it was discovered that their content was heavily optimized for broad fashion keywords while neglecting their unique brand ethos of sustainable fashion. This misalignment not only confused customers but also attracted the wrong audience, leading to lower conversions.

Case Study 2: Tech Start-Up

A tech company specializing in AI solutions used highly technical jargon in their SEO strategy, which did not align with their goal to make AI accessible to non-tech-savvy users. The inconsistency in messaging and audience targeting resulted in a high bounce rate and poor user engagement.

Strategies to Align SEO with Brand Messaging

To prevent and correct misalignments, consider the following strategies:

  • Develop a comprehensive brand guideline that includes tone, style, and core messaging to be reflected in all SEO efforts.
  • Conduct regular audits of SEO content to ensure it aligns with the brand’s values and messaging.
  • Involve brand managers in the SEO planning process to maintain a unified brand voice across all content.
  • Focus on creating quality content that serves the user’s needs and strengthens the brand’s identity.

Conclusion

In conclusion, while SEO is essential for digital visibility, it must not come at the cost of brand consistency. Misalignments between SEO and brand messaging can lead to confusion, customer distrust, and ultimately, diminished brand equity. By integrating SEO with clear, consistent brand messaging, businesses can not only enhance their search engine rankings but also build a strong, coherent brand identity that resonates with their audience.
